What Does WDYM Mean?

WDYM stands for:

“What Do You Mean?”

People use it when they want clarification, more information, or an explanation about something another person has said.

Quick Definition

  • Internet slang abbreviation
  • Used in text messages and online chats
  • Requests clarification or explanation
  • Usually informal and conversational

Simple Examples

“WDYM you already left?”

“WDYM that’s not the right answer?”

“WDYM you don’t like pizza?”

In each example, the speaker is asking the other person to explain what they mean.

Origin & Background

The Rise of Text Abbreviations

WDYM emerged during the early growth of texting culture. Mobile phones once had limited keyboards, making shorter messages more convenient.

As internet communication expanded, users began shortening common phrases into abbreviations. Similar examples include:

  • LOL (Laugh Out Loud)
  • BRB (Be Right Back)
  • IMO (In My Opinion)
  • IDK (I Don’t Know)

WDYM naturally joined this group because “What do you mean?” is a question people ask frequently in conversations.

Social Media Influence

Platforms such as Instagram, Snapchat, TikTok, and Twitter accelerated the use of abbreviations. Fast-paced conversations encouraged users to type fewer characters while maintaining the same meaning.

Young users especially embraced these shortcuts because they matched the speed of online communication.

How the Meaning Evolved

Originally, WDYM simply requested clarification.

Today, context often adds emotional layers. Depending on the situation, WDYM can express:

  • Confusion
  • Surprise
  • Disbelief
  • Curiosity
  • Frustration
  • Playfulness

The meaning remains the same, but the tone changes based on the conversation.

Common Misunderstandings

People Think It Is Rude

Some individuals interpret WDYM as confrontational.

In reality, the phrase is usually neutral. The surrounding conversation determines whether it feels friendly or aggressive.

Tone Can Be Misread

Without emojis or additional context, readers may assume the wrong emotional tone.

For example:

“WDYM?”

can feel very different from:

“WDYM? 😊”

Literal vs Figurative Meaning

Sometimes people use WDYM because they genuinely don’t understand.

Other times, they already understand but express surprise or disbelief.

Context matters.

Variations / Types

WYM

Short for “What You Mean?”

A shorter version commonly used in texting.

WDYM?

The standard abbreviation with a question mark.

Adds clarity and proper punctuation.

WDYMMM

An extended version emphasizing surprise.

Shows stronger emotion.

WDYM Bro

A friendly variation used among friends.

Adds an informal tone.

WDYM Exactly

Used when seeking detailed clarification.

Requests a more specific explanation.

WDYM By That

Asks about a particular statement or idea.

Often appears in debates.

Wait WDYM

Combines surprise with confusion.

Common on social media.

Seriously WDYM

Shows disbelief while requesting clarification.

Frequently used in emotional conversations.

WDYM LOL

Mixes confusion with humor.

Keeps the conversation lighthearted.

WDYM Fr

“Fr” means “for real.”

Used when someone is genuinely surprised.
